Course Details

Healthcare Project Management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of project management, specific to the healthcare industry, including project life cycle, initiation, planning, execution, monitoring, and closure.
Strategic Planning in Healthcare: Developing strategic plans to align with the organization's mission, vision, and goals, including market analysis, stakeholder management, and resource allocation.
Project Planning and Scheduling: Creating detailed project plans, defining project scope, setting objectives, and developing schedules, budgets, and timelines.
Healthcare Operations Management: Overseeing the daily operations of healthcare facilities, managing resources, improving processes, and ensuring quality and safety standards are met.
Project Risk Management: Identifying, assessing, and mitigating potential risks and challenges in healthcare project management, including legal, regulatory, and ethical considerations.
Healthcare Technology Management: Implementing and managing technology solutions to improve patient care, streamline operations, and reduce costs, including electronic health records (EHRs), telehealth, and data analytics.
Healthcare Financial Management: Understanding financial management principles, including budgeting, cost control, reimbursement models, and financial reporting.
Leadership and Team Management: Developing leadership skills, building and managing high-performing teams, and fostering a collaborative and innovative culture in healthcare organizations.
Healthcare Compliance and Regulations: Ensuring compliance with relevant laws, regulations, and standards, including HIPAA, Joint Commission, and CMS.
